Wondering how folks are doing with importation of data.
1) Are current import options adequate?
2) How will the default import tree look like?
3) Are there standards for EMR on categories of import?
4) Will there be (or are there)methods of customizing imporation categories practice wide?

Here's a quick tree that I would like for my practice unless there is compelling reasons to use other categories.

DIAGNOSTICS
Laboratory
Pathology
EKG
Nerve Conduction Studies
Radiology/Imaging
DEXASCAN
Nuclear Bone Scan
MRI, X-ray, U/S
Vascular studies
Echocardiogram
Mammogram

MEDICAL CORRESPONDENCE
L&I
OUTPATIENT
Consults
Physical therapy
INPATIENT
Hospital consultation
H&P
Discharge Summary
Operative Summary

LEGAL CORRESPONDENCE
ATTORNEYS
INSURANCE COMPANIES (Referrals, denials, etc)

I have one primary complaint about the Imported Data options. We primarily scan items into the chart. We dont attach files very often. The Non-Medical Item folder only appears as an option when you attach a file, not when you scan. I would really like to see this folder appear as an option to place the scanned item during the scanning process when it asks to attach to chart.

Currently, if we haven't attached a file to the chart, we cant even "drag & drop" a scanned item to the non-medical folder. This causes useless sign-offs to be sent to the doctor, while the staff has to remember to execute extra mouse-clicks.
